What Is a Door with a Sliding Window?
A door with a sliding window is exactly what it sounds like: a door geared up with a built-in window that moves open and closed. These doors can be available in a broad variety of products, including wood, metal, fiberglass, or vinyl, and the sliding window can be positioned in different parts of the door, depending upon design preferences or practicality. Typically found in kitchen areas, patios, front entrances, and offices, they bring a perfect combination of functionality and design.
The Practical Advantages of Sliding Window Doors
1. Improved Ventilation
Among the most apparent benefits of a door with a sliding window is its ability to enhance airflow in your area. By just sliding the window open, you can let fresh air inside without requiring to open the whole door. This function is particularly useful in homes with family pets or small kids, as it enables for ventilation without compromising safety.
2. Boosted Natural Light
The inclusion of a window quickly raises the visual of any door, permitting an influx of natural light into your interior areas. Whether it's a patio area door with a fully glazed sliding window or an entry door with a smaller sized glass area, the additional light improves a home's ambiance and heat.
3. Controlled Privacy
A sliding window adds flexibility to your personal privacy alternatives. Lots of styles include frosted, tinted, or ornamental glass, permitting light to go into while preserving personal privacy. Some models even provide removable panels or blinds for complete control over exposure.
4. Energy Efficiency
Modern sliding window doors are manufactured with premium materials and advanced glazing technologies to guarantee exceptional insulation. Dual-pane or low-emissivity (low-E) glass alternatives keep indoor temperature levels steady, decreasing cooling and heating costs.
5. Benefit

Whether you're passing kitchen area basics out to a yard BBQ or chatting with a messenger without opening the whole door, the sliding window function makes life more convenient. It's also excellent for people with reduced mobility who might find standard doors more difficult to manage.
6. Safety Features
Modern styles typically consist of robust security features such as reinforced frames, locks, and shatter-resistant glass. These enhancements make sure that the sliding window doesn't end up being a security threat, providing comfort for homeowners.

Maintenance and Longevity
Another enticing function of doors with sliding windows is their low-maintenance nature. The windows are generally easy to clean, and top quality materials used in construction make sure durability. Periodic lubrication of the sliding track and routine examinations for drafts or wear-and-tear will keep these doors in prime condition for years.
